Premier League Best Bets: Fulham v Newcastle

 

I like to follow some final-day trends when matchday 38 of a Premier League season rolls around. No-card games are much more common on this weekend than any other – two of last season’s 15 came on the last day – while overall card counts also tend to be lower. With the pressure off certain sides, goals also often fly in. We’ve had six-goal games in three of the last four seasons, with 2023’s conclusion featuring a 4-4 draw between Southampton and Liverpool.

 

That game meant nothing and that rings true for Fulham v Newcastle this weekend. With both having missed out on Europe, all pressure has been removed and I would not be surprised to see a wide-open game. Yes, Fulham have struggled for goals of late but their expected-goals figure has been way higher than their actual output, while Newcastle arrive having scored seven in their last three.

 

The aforementioned Osula is on fire with five goals in his last six games, while even Nick Woltemade rediscovered his scoring touch last weekend. Injury issues for Sandro Tonali and Joelinton could leave Newcastle more open in the middle of the park, too. All things considered, I think this is a game which could deliver goals and taking a punt on over 5.5 goals is the shout.
